I was born and raised in Boston and live in Vermont heres my ideas


You are going to need to rent a car

You must visit , China Town , Paul Revere's house , The old North Church , Faneuil Hall , old Iron Side , The Prudential and the Hancock building ....if you can get slightly out of the city go to Lexington ... thats where the first battle of the revaluation was.
